The paint film exhibits good adhesion to steel, as well as excellent water resistance and corrosion resistance. Suitable for storage tanks, bridges, power plants, etc., as an anti-corrosion topcoat for steel structures and concrete surfaces. The place where we use it the most is the pipeline racks within the factory premises.

The maximum operating temperature for ordinary high-density polyethylene PE is 70°C; in long-term use, it should generally not exceed 65°C. It is resistant to corrosion by non-oxidizing acids, but not to corrosion by oxidizing acids; Chlorosulfonated polyethylene HYPALON can withstand temperatures up to 140°C, and it is resistant to corrosion by most oxidizing acids, including strong oxidizing acids such as sulfuric acid and nitric acid. However, it is not resistant to petroleum-based and aromatic media, and it is expensive.
